on top of being a collector i do quite a lot of metal detecting in the south of France. 
 
A few days ago i found what i think to be a "handgonne". I found it not far from a ruined tower and a small spanish church in the vicinity of Perpignan in the south of France. The spot is a strategic hilltop in a region where the kingdom of France and the Kingdom of spain fought over centuries. 
 
When i cleaned it, it was packed with remains of black powder. But i can not find a "touch hole".  
 
I read somewhere that some kind of early handgonne had no touch hole and were ignited by the front end of the barrel .
